Pharmacokinetics in Geriatric Patients: Effect of Age on Drug Distribution

Drug distribution in the human body is influenced by several factors, including plasma protein concentration, body composition, blood flow, tissue-protein concentration, and tissue fluid pH. Among these, changes in plasma protein concentration and body composition due to aging significantly affect how drugs are distributed within the body. Consensus research priorities in geriatric oncology: A Delphi study.

Amanda Drury1, Aoife O'Brien2, Sarah Sheehan3

  • 1School of Nursing and Midwifery, Trinity College Dublin, 24 D'Olier Street, Dublin 2, Ireland..

Journal of Geriatric Oncology
|July 10, 2026
PubMed
Summary

Older adults living with or after cancer need research focused on treatment development, decision-making, and integrated care. This study identified key geriatric oncology survivorship priorities through expert consensus.

Area of Science:

  • Geriatric Oncology
  • Cancer Survivorship Research
  • Health Services Research

Background:

  • Meaningful involvement of older adults in cancer survivorship research is limited globally.
  • Priorities for geriatric oncology survivorship research need to be established, especially outside North America.

Purpose of the Study:

  • To establish consensus on key research priorities in geriatric oncology survivorship.
  • To incorporate the perspectives of older adults living with or after cancer and other stakeholders.

Main Methods:

  • Modified Delphi methodology involving 60 experts (including older adults, caregivers, healthcare professionals, researchers).
  • Assessment of 55 research priorities across four Delphi rounds.
  • Consensus defined as ≥80% agreement.

Main Results:

  • 37 research priorities achieved consensus.
  • Top priorities include treatment development (98%), decision-making (96%), healthcare professional awareness of cancer symptoms in older adults (96%), rehabilitation programs (96%), and management of multimorbidity (96%) and frailty (96%).

Conclusions:

  • A consensus-based framework for geriatric oncology survivorship research priorities was established.
  • Treatment development is a key priority, alongside research in decision-making, integrated care, and rehabilitation.
  • Findings emphasize the need to address the holistic needs of older adults living with and after cancer.
